Respiratory function and risk of stroke

S G Wannamethee1, A G Shaper, S Ebrahim

  • 1Department of Public Health, Royal Free Hospital School of Medicine, London, UK.

Stroke
|November 1, 1995
PubMed
Summary

Reduced lung function, measured by forced expiratory volume in 1 second (FEV1), is linked to a higher stroke risk, particularly in men with existing hypertension or ischemic heart disease. However, FEV1 is not recommended for guiding hypertension treatment decisions for stroke prevention.

Background:

  • Lung function, specifically forced expiratory volume in 1 second (FEV1), is increasingly recognized as a potential indicator of systemic health.
  • The relationship between pulmonary function and cardiovascular risk, particularly stroke, requires further elucidation.

Purpose of the Study:

  • To investigate the association between lung function (FEV1) and the risk of major stroke events (fatal and nonfatal).
  • To determine if FEV1 can serve as a predictive marker for stroke risk in a middle-aged male population.

Main Methods:

  • A prospective study involving 7735 men aged 40-59 was conducted.
  • Forced expiratory volume in 1 second (FEV1) was measured, and participants were followed for a mean of 14.8 years for major stroke events.

  • Statistical analyses adjusted for multiple cardiovascular risk factors including age, smoking, blood pressure, and diabetes.
  • Main Results:

    • Lower FEV1 levels were significantly associated with an increased risk of major stroke events.
    • The relative risk of stroke was 1.4 times higher in the lowest FEV1 group compared to the highest.
    • This association was more pronounced in older men, current nonsmokers, hypertensive individuals, and those with pre-existing ischemic heart disease.

    Conclusions:

    • Reduced lung function (FEV1) is associated with elevated stroke risk, especially in high-risk individuals with hypertension or ischemic heart disease.
    • While FEV1 indicates increased stroke risk, its predictive value is insufficient to guide clinical decisions for hypertension management in stroke prevention.
